私はシステム間の移植性が好きで、私のエディタはできるだけnano
Sublime Text(Linux Mintの場合)に似ているように見えます。関数名にも色を付けたいです。これまで、私は次のようにこれを行いました。
私が使っているコードはちょっとしたチートです。void
次の空間まで自分自身と後ろの空間を着色します。
color brightyellow start="void " end="[ ]"
color cyan "void"
2回着色した理由はvoid
明るい黄色に変わるため、次のようなコードを書く必要があります。
void fu (void);
fu
との間にスペースがあります(
。
しかし、コードを次のように書くと:
void fu(void);
故障しました。
私の質問は、start="void " end="("
単語自体を無視して開始する方法で書く方法です。c.nanorc
void
(